I'm frustrated but optimistic.

Look, I'm sure that supporting every possible input configuration on PC is a nightmare, especially in the universe of racing wheels.

But I'm really unhappy with not just how they want you to map inputs, but also the strange lack of responsiveness to inputs sometimes in-game.

I'd say that shifting gears is working for me only most of the time. My handbrake seems to get stuck at the start of a stage, too? And this is in addition to the game flat-out refusing to let me use my admittedly no-name USB handbrake. (Like, it's not just a matter of it merely not really working. It's basically saying "nah, we're not gonna let you use that".)

As for the game as-intended... I had managed my expectations coming in given the lack of stage variety, and that's all fine: I knew what I was buying, in that sense. I've never driven rally in real life, but I assume the physics are pretty authentic and it's definitely demanding a different driving style than other rally games... how much that experience is for me remains to be seen, honestly. I at least have an academic appreciation for what they're doing, but maybe I want something less punishing.

But the input customization is really not at industry standard (which is an enormous hurdle to my enthusiasm and willingness to spend more time with the game as-is), and I think that's really important. For me to even want to get good at their more challenging sim requires that they meet me halfway and don't make me wrestle with both input problems AND more authentic physics.

Also, they're doing Early Access and have no bug reporting tool in-game?

Finally, I'm really concerned about this being another Unreal Engine rally game with stuttering and other performance issues. We've seen this movie already with EA WRC.
